Signed team configuration and encrypted sync

Switchyard can share portable project templates, policy packs, curated plugin metadata, and enterprise configuration without a hosted account. This feature is optional: a fresh installation has no trusted publisher, bundle, sync key, registry, or remote dependency.

Trust model

Every switchyard.bundle/v1 document is signed with Ed25519 over a canonical envelope. Installation succeeds only when all of these checks pass:

  1. the publisher’s exact public key was trusted with explicit confirmation;
  2. the publisher ID is the SHA-256-derived identity of that key;
  3. the bundle signature, schema, kind, ID, timestamps, and expiration pass;
  4. its JSON payload is bounded, kind-specific, and portable; and
  5. the payload contains no secret-bearing fields, private keys, or absolute host paths.

Signing private keys and age identities are CLI-owned files and are never sent to the daemon. Generate a new owner-only signing key, verify its public identity, and trust the public half through an independently authenticated channel:

switchyard team key generate --output maintainer.signing-key.json
switchyard team key show maintainer.signing-key.json
switchyard team publisher trust --name "Maintainers" \
--public-key <reviewed-base64-public-key> --yes

Do not commit private signing-key or age-identity files. Rotate a compromised publisher by ceasing to install its bundles and distributing a newly generated public identity out of band. The current v1 trust store is additive; removing a publisher is deliberately not an unaudited shortcut.

Bundle workflow

Payloads are ordinary bounded JSON documents. Sign and install them as separate reviewed operations:

switchyard team bundle sign policy-pack org-policy \
--name "Organization policy" --version 1.0.0 \
--payload policy.json --key maintainer.signing-key.json \
--output org-policy.bundle.json
switchyard team bundle install org-policy.bundle.json --yes
switchyard team bundle list
switchyard team policy
switchyard team registry

Project-template payloads contain a manifest and a bounded variable catalog. Rendering replaces only declared {{variable}} placeholders and validates the complete result with the normal project-manifest validator before it can be written:

switchyard team template render template.go-service \
--set name=payments --set root=/work/payments \
--output switchyard.project.json

Policy packs use allowlists. Multiple packs and enterprise configurations are combined by restrictive intersection, so an empty allowed list denies that optional capability. Team policy can restrict remote inventory and lifecycle actions, registry publishers, and whether a user may opt in to anonymous metrics. It never broadens the built-in permission model.

A signed plugin registry supplies metadata, HTTPS download locations, and SHA-256 digests only. Registry discovery does not download, install, trust, enable, or grant capabilities to a plugin. The normal exact-fingerprint and least-privilege plugin review remains mandatory.

Encrypted configuration sync

Sync exports only trusted public publishers and their verified portable bundles. It excludes projects, repository paths and contents, machine or tunnel credentials, fleet registrations, operations, logs, terminals, environment values, settings, and runtime state.

Create an age X25519 identity on the receiving machine and share only its recipient string:

switchyard team sync key-generate --output receiving-machine.agekey
switchyard team sync export --recipient age1... --output team-config.age
switchyard team sync preview team-config.age \
--identity receiving-machine.agekey
switchyard team sync import team-config.age \
--identity receiving-machine.agekey --yes

The encrypted file uses the standard armored age format. Preview decrypts only in memory, validates every public identity and signature, lists bundle IDs, and warns about replaced publisher metadata or signed bundle revisions. Import requires a second explicit confirmation. Encryption protects confidentiality; signature verification and the review step establish publisher trust.

Back up signing keys and age identities with the same controls used for other developer credentials. Losing an age identity makes its encrypted exports unrecoverable. Losing a signing key does not affect installed bundles, but new revisions must use a newly trusted publisher.
